Towns and villages call to replace single electoral constituency with several

The Towns and Villages Association has sent an open letter to Prime Minister Eduard Heger in which it claimed that Slovakia has a problem with insufficient representation of individual regions in Parliament, calling for the single electoral constituency in Slovakia to replaced with several in general elections. “We are asking for information on what changes the governing coalition is planning in relation to replacing the one constituency in general elections with another, better solution. We do not think that we have time for philosophising today. We need actions," Association stated in the letter. The Interior Ministry told the TASR news agency in December 2021 that a working group had been set up to deal with the issue of replacing the one-constituency system. The group is expected to draw up recommendations for alternatives as well as specific amendments to the Electoral Act.
